Beyond (NYSE:BYON) Posts Earnings Results, Misses Estimates By $0.30 EPS

Beyond (NYSE:BYONGet Free Report) issued its quarterly earnings data on Monday. The company reported ($1.22) ear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.92) by ($0.30), Briefing.com reports. Beyond had a negative return on equity of 16.92% and a negative net margin of 19.72%. The company had revenue of $382.28 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$389.36 million. During the same quarter last year, the company earned ($0.10) ear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up .3% compared to the same quarter last year.

Beyond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Beyond, Inc operates as an online retailer of furniture and home furnishings products in the United States and Canada. The company offers furniture, bedding and bath, patio and outdoor gear, area rugs, tabletop and cookware, décor, storage and organization, small appliances, home improvement, and other products under the Bed Bath & Beyond brand.
